Output 45bb26fe1f3bc993ba7a1e13947d18a9403818d25aa2884aab3870fc933cb252:104

value
150754
script pubkey
OP_0 OP_PUSHBYTES_20 66e37e84d5c30bc67f8e40ef07d4de998d306725
address
bc1qvm3hapx4cv9uvluwgrhs04x7nxxnqee97np4ud
transaction
45bb26fe1f3bc993ba7a1e13947d18a9403818d25aa2884aab3870fc933cb252